Step 1: Assessment and Planning
We begin by inspecting your property to identify the source and extent of the damage. This involves using specialized equipment to detect moisture, check for structural integrity, and assess the risk of further damage. The sooner we start, the sooner we can stop the damage from spreading. Within 60 minutes, our team will have a clear plan of action, including the necessary equipment and personnel to get the job done.
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ying
With our state-of-the-art equipment, we extract as much water as possible from your property, using a combination of pumps and vacuums to remove standing water and moisture from walls, floors, and ceilings. Removing water quickly and efficiently prevents further damage and reduces the risk of mold growth. Our technicians work methodically to dry every inch of your property, using specialized equipment to monitor moisture levels and ensure a thorough job.
Step 3: Sanitizing and Dehumidification
Once the water is removed and your property is dry, we focus on sanitizing and dehumidifying your space. This step is crucial in preventing mold growth and ensuring a healthy living environment. Our technicians use specialized equipment to remove any remaining moisture, bacteria, and viruses, leaving your property clean and safe.

After Hours Water Removal Cost in Mount Airy, MD
Cost is always a concern with water damage restoration, and for good reason. The sooner you act, the less you’ll pay. Our team offers a free estimate and a transparent pricing structure, so you know exactly what to expect. The typical price range for After Hours Water Removal in Mount Airy, MD is between $500 and $2,500, dep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in your neighborhood. These estimates are based on industry standards and our own experience working with homeowners in the area. Keep in mind that every job is unique, and the final price will depend on the specifics of your situation.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ction and Drying |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ment needed |
| Sanitizing and Dehumidification | $300 – $1,500 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, complexity of job |
| Repair and Reconstruction |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ials needed, complexity of job |
| Final Inspection and Guarantee | $100 – $500 | Timeliness of inspection, complexity of job, satisfaction guarantee |
| Emergency Response and Assessment | $200 – $1,000 | Timeliness of response, complexity of job, equipment needed |
